Waldom Electronics launches Tyco Electronics’ Potter & Brumfield (P&B) Relay Program to assist distributors in obtaining Tyco Electronics Relays
Rockford, IllinoisJuly 12, 2010Waldom Electronics, a leading wholesaler of electronic and electrical components selling exclusively to distributors, announced the launch of its new P&B Relay Program. The P&B Relay Program consists of 1,000 part numbers from this well-known brand of Tyco Electronics. It includes the most popular general purpose relays, power relays, timers and sockets. The benefits of the P&B Relay Program are listed below:
- Waldom Electronics to offer stock on 1,000 P&B relay, timer and socket part numbers
- No minimum order quantity per part number
- Distributors can achieve cost savings by combining purchases:
- Two combinable groups: Group A and Group B
- Purchases within each group can be combined to achieve cost savings
- Quantities can only be combined for part numbers in each group

About Tyco Electronics’ Potter & Brumfield relays
P&B relays, timers and sockets are among the many products of Tyco Electronics. P&B products have been meeting industry’s needs for more than 75 years. The broad P&B relay line offers ratings from dry circuit to 125A, arrangements from 1A to 8C, AC or DC input and many other options.
About Tyco Electronics
Tyco Electronics Ltd. is a leading global provider of engineered electronic components, network solutions, specialty products and undersea telecommunication systems, with fiscal 2009 sales of US$10.3 billion to customers in more than 150 countries. Tyco Electronics designs, manufactures and markets products for customers in a broad array of industries including automotive; data communication systems and consumer electronics; telecommunications; aerospace, defense and marine; medical; energy; and lighting.
